The Legal Gambling Age in Las Vegas: A Concise Guide

The legal gambling age in Las Vegas is 21. This age applies to all casinos and hotels that offer gambling, regardless of whether they are located on the Strip or off. It is important to note that the legal drinking age in Las Vegas is also 21, and casinos may require identification to confirm age for both drinking and gambling.

A Beginner’s Guide to Age Requirements in Las Vegas Casinos

For beginners who may not be familiar with the age restrictions in Las Vegas casinos, it is important to know that identification will be required to confirm age before participating in any type of gambling. Visitors should bring a government-issued ID such as a driver’s license or passport.

It is also important to research the age requirements for specific casinos and types of gambling before visiting. This can help avoid disappointment and ensure a smoother experience. Visitors should note that even if they are not gambling, they may still be required to show ID to enter certain areas of the casino.

The age restrictions for gambling in Las Vegas are in place for several reasons. The first is to comply with state laws, which set the minimum age for gambling and drinking at 21 years old. The second is to prevent underage gambling and the negative consequences that can come with it, such as addiction, debt, and legal trouble.

Casinos enforce age restrictions by requiring identification at various points throughout the gambling experience. This may include at the hotel check-in, when entering the casino, and when cashing out winnings. Visitors who are found to be underage may be asked to leave, and in some cases, may face legal consequences such as fines or even jail time.
